Should I carry out the sacked task of burial according to my little girls directions, or should I make a quick job of it by detouring to NAUTA STEELE Special to the Lakeside Convenient Premade Mixes Save Time LYNDIA GRAHAM Review in Correspondent mixes can not only save time but money, said Ermona Rigby, a Layton homemaker who enjoys the convenience of mixes but the taste of homemade. I like to take a day and get all of my mixes made, she said, Then Im ready to go for a long time. There is nothing more frustrating to me than to reach into the cupboard and realize that I am out of a mix. She said that one secret to making good mixes is to use quality ingredients, a trick she attributes to her mothers training. I can remember her saying, if you use quality ingredients you get a quality product, she added, that the best way to buy any of the mix ingredients is when they are on sale to further cut the cost of the homemade Make-at-hom- e , mixes. She also suggests that they be properly labeled as they are made so errors wont be made at the actual cooking time or if husband or children want to whip up a little surprise. Mixes are a good way to rotate food storage items, especially powered milk according to Mrs. Rigby. By adding the powdered milk to the basic mix, water alone can be added to many recipes making them very simple to mix up.
